To Be With YouMr. BIG

This is a song released in 1991 by the American hard rock band MR.
BIG.
It was included on the album Lean Into It.
The simple performance and lyrics—where a man who has single-mindedly loved one woman tells her, as she cries over being heartbroken by another man, “I’m the one who should be with you”—really hit home.
Right Here WaitingRichard Marx

This is a song from “Repeat Offender,” the album released in 1989 by American singer-songwriter Richard Marx.
The track set a record by spending four consecutive weeks at number one on the U.
S.
charts.
Expressing an almost maddening longing for his lover, the piece is said to have been set to music directly from a love letter Richard wrote to the woman he was dating at the time.
I WillThe Beatles

The legendary band The Beatles has, quite literally, an enormous number of hit songs.
This particular track was included on their 1968 double album, commonly known as the White Album, and it’s a relatively understated piece within their body of work.
However, its content is pure romance: a song that says, “No matter how lonely I get, I’ll wait for you for the rest of my life.” It’s a hidden gem by the Beatles, and a favorite among many fans.
To Love You MoreCéline Dion

This is a song by a Canadian female singer that was tied in as the theme song for the Japanese TV drama “Koibito yo.” It sings of a woman’s feelings of love as she continues to think of the person she loves.
Céline Dion’s beautiful voice and powerful vocal ability make it a compelling, passionate love song.
Uptown GirlBilly Joel

This is the second single from Billy Joel’s 1983 album An Innocent Man, a song familiar in Japan from commercials and the like.
If you think you’re not a match for the person you admire, listen to this song and take heart.
It’s about a guy from the old neighborhood boldly making a move on a classy girl!
